Carol S. Ryan is a scholar working on Molecular Biology, Oncology and Immunology. According to data from OpenAlex, Carol S. Ryan has authored 10 papers receiving a total of 647 indexed citations (citations by other indexed papers that have themselves been cited), including 3 papers in Molecular Biology, 3 papers in Oncology and 3 papers in Immunology. Recurrent topics in Carol S. Ryan's work include Cytokine Signaling Pathways and Interactions (2 papers), Cardiovascular, Neuropeptides, and Oxidative Stress Research (1 paper) and Porphyrin Metabolism and Disorders (1 paper). Carol S. Ryan is often cited by papers focused on Cytokine Signaling Pathways and Interactions (2 papers), Cardiovascular, Neuropeptides, and Oxidative Stress Research (1 paper) and Porphyrin Metabolism and Disorders (1 paper). Carol S. Ryan collaborates with scholars based in United States, Germany and Canada. Carol S. Ryan's co-authors include Rodrigo Bravo, Karen S. Dorfman, Sérgio A. Lira, M C Gruda, Rodrigo Bravo, Rolf-Peter Ryseck, Yuhong Zhou, Glenn A. Warr, Takao Kurihara and Yi Yang and has published in prestigious journals such as The Journal of Experimental Medicine, Journal of Clinical Oncology and The Journal of Immunology.
